Priority meeting may be convened bi-annually
Tribune News Service
Shimla, January 8
The state government will consider organising the MLA priorities meeting bi-annually so that progress in the work of MLA priorities could be reviewed, said Chief Minister Jai Ram Thakur while presiding over the second session of the meeting of MLA priorities for the financial year 2020-21 with the MLAs of Mandi and Kinnaur districts here late last evening.
The Chief Minister said this meeting was vital for overall development of the state. He directed the officers to adopt proactive approach to ensure that policies and programmes of the state government reach the person belonging at the lowest level.

MLA Karsog Hira Lal demanded that Atal Adarsh Vidyalaya should be opened in his area. He also urged for developing Tattapani from tourism point of view.
MLA Sundernagar Rakesh Jamwal demanded that the work at Sundernagar hospital should be started. He further sought rationalization of a sub division of electricity in his constituency and setting up of 220 KV sub-station at Sundernagar.
MLA Nachan Vinod Kumar sought exclusion of a few areas of his constituency from the Town and Country Planning preview to facilitate the people. He requested for sewerage scheme for Gohar and Kanaid and also demanded enhancing MLA Fund.
MLA Drang Jawahar Thakur pleaded for improvement of roads in his area. He also demanded opening of a Civil Court at Padhar and exploring the area from tourism point of view.
MLA Jogindernagar Prakash Rana said that civil hospital at Ladbhadol must be constructed on a priority. He also urged for providing funds for Ladbhadol Degree College and construction of ambulance roads.
MLA Mandi Anil Sharma said that 24-hour water supply should be made available to Mandi town. He said that a stadium be constructed in Mandi for promoting sports activities in the area.
MLA Balh Inder Singh Gandhi said that health facilities in upper area of Balh must be strengthened. He also demanded strengthening of animal husbandry services in Upper Balh area.
MLA Sarkaghat Col Inder Singh said special emphasis must be laid on maintaining roads in the area. He also urged for channelization of Seer Khud.
MLA Kinnaur Jagat Singh Negi sought that the preparation of DPRs of various development projects should be fast-tracked. He also said there was need for increasing the amount under MLA Fund. He said that mining lease be given in Kinnaur district.
Chief Secretary Anil Kumar Khachi assured the Chief Minister that the officers would work with dedication and commitment to come up to the expectations of the state government. He also asked the officers to come with innovative ideas and new schemes.
